We are setting up a new repository on a Unix machine and have set up a user
list that gives the appropriate developers read/write access to the CVSROOT
directory.  Logins for the users occur without a problem, but when any of
the users try to check out a module the following error is returned:

cvs server: cannot open /root/.cvsignore: Permission Denied
cvs [server aborted]: can't chdir(/root): Permission Denied

MIS doesn't want to give everyone write access to the root directory.  Is
there an Environment variable that will place the .cvsignore file in the
CVSROOT directory?
